Forest Quest

Forest Quest is an AR-powered app designed to encourage children to explore the Oberderdingen forest by blending outdoor adventure with engaging digital challenges and educational activities.

Context

A group project for the Media Interaction Production lecture, in collaboration with the Landratsamt Karlsruhe, Forestry Department and the Municipality of Oberderdingen.

Problem

The Decline of Outdoor Play in a Digital Age

As children increasingly favor digital games over outdoor play, physical activity levels are dropping, especially among 8 to 12-year-olds. The challenge is to use kids' interest in digital media to inspire them to explore nature and connect with the outdoors.

Solution

Inspiring Curiosity Through Challenges

Forest Quest is a two-level AR app designed to make exploring the forest both fun and educational. In Level 1, users explore stations along the Oberderdingen forest trail, taking selfies to unlock badges and quizzes as keepsakes. In Level 2, users embark on virtual animal hunts, collecting animal families to complete the challenge. Completing both levels earns an invitation to an annual tree-planting event with the Oberderdingen Forestry Office, encouraging environmental stewardship.

1

Explore the Oberderdingen Forest Trail

  • An interactive map shows users’ location on the forest trail.
  • Stations appear on the map, allowing users to access them quickly as they approach.
2

Collect Badges

  • Displays available badges, organized by Stations and Animal Families.
  • Users tap badges at each station to complete challenges, collecting all badges to unlock the tree-planting invitation.
3

Complete AR Challenges

  • Open the AR camera to tackle station-based challenges.
  • Users take a selfie to earn their badge and create a digital memory.
4

Find and Collect Animals

  • Users receive notifications when an animal is nearby.
  • Use the AR camera to "catch" animals and collect enough to form complete families.
5

Interactive Exploration

  • Discover and interact with 3D objects on the forest trail using the AR camera.
  • Users can take selfies with these objects to enhance their experience.
6

Complete Quizzes at Home

  • Each station has a unique, themed quiz that users can complete to learn more about the trail.

Impact

Cultivating Young Environmental Stewards Through Interactive Learning

Forest Quest transforms forest exploration into an engaging adventure, attracting young visitors to the Oberderdingen trail. The app fosters a deeper connection to nature through AR challenges, virtual animal collections, and knowledge-based quizzes. By inviting users who complete the app’s levels to participate in an annual tree-planting event, Forest Quest strengthens community involvement and environmental responsibility among youth.
